  • Abstract
    The paper is to explore protection management method for Chinese historical cities nowadays. By using investigation of the status quo of protection, the authors found out problems exist in protection management of present Chinese historical cities, and carefully analyzed its technical priority in protection for historical cities according to characteristic of network technology. Network technology that has quickly developed in China is brought forward to solve those problems that could not be solved in traditional way, such as public participation and transportation. On the other hand, combining actuality of Chinese historical cities, the paper also points out shortage of network technology application. Most retained historical cities in China are middle and small cities, whereas the development of network technology there are slow generally. In the long run, applying network technology to protect historical cities in China is a very good method, and it needs further research for finding an appropriate development road for the situation of middle and small cities.
